欢迎关注VX公众号:英语主播Emily 获取更多免费学习课程和资料 Steven is a wealthy man but he's very economical. And Jack can't understand it and asks him the reason.** 史蒂文很富有,但依然很节俭。对此杰克很不理解,于是询问原因。 A: Hey Steven.You have a large chunk of money, but why do you still live in the old flat instead of buying a new villa? 嘿,史蒂文。你有大把的钱,为什么还住在那个旧公寓里,而不买一套别墅呢? B: I like to live here and enjoy my neighbor's company. And I don't think I should waste money just because I have much of it. 我喜欢这儿,喜欢周围的邻居们。而且我不认为因为我有钱就可以随意地挥霍。 A: But I found you always hate to part with your money. Look at the car you drive. It's such a junker.  但是我发现你很舍不得花钱,看看你开的车都破成什么样了? B: Oh, the car is old but still in good condition. I just think we should be thrifty whether you're rich or not. 哦,那车是破了点,但性能还很好。我觉得无论我们是贫穷还是富有,都应该节俭。 A: But, but... 可是,可是... B: But what? Just remember that thrift is not only a great virtue, but also a great revenue. 可是什么?记住,节俭不仅是一大美德,而且是一大财源。 A: Maybe you're right. 也许你说得对。 Pronunciation:** is a**→zə** understand it→dɪ have a**→və** chunk of→kə live in→vɪ instead of→də much of it→tʃə;vɪ but I**→daɪ** found you always→dʒuːwɔː look at→kə** such a**→tʃə** car is old→rɪ;zəʊ still in→lɪ rich or not→tʃɔːr** not only a→dəʊ;jə** but also a→dɔ;wə**
